Twilight of the Estado da India 170 Bibliography 195 Glossary 208 Index 209 Shihan de Silva Jayasuriya is Senior Fellow at the Institute of Commonwealth Studies, University of London. She is an Elected Fellow of the Royal Asiatic Society, Great Britain and Ireland, and is also associated with the Department of Portuguese and Brazilian Studies, King’s College London. She obtained her Ph.D. in Linguistics at the University of Westminster, London. She is the author of Tagus to Taprobane, An Anthology of Indo-Portuguese Verse, Indo-Portuguese of Ceylon and African Identity in Asia, and editor of Sounds of Identity, The African Diaspora in Asia: Historical Gleanings, Invisible Africans: Hidden Communities in Asia, Uncovering the History of Africans in Asia and The African Diaspora in the Indian Ocean (co-edited with Richard Pankhurst).
